Address

EQ6FBPLrcWPkYYMbPhAvYWEDqiTRvC3X1L

61.80167166 VIA
13.94 DKK

Confirmed
Total Received61.80167166 VIA13.94 DKK
Total Sent0 VIA0.00 DKK
Final Balance61.80167166 VIA13.94 DKK
No. Transactions1

Transactions

Vwa5xKwHL12GruQ7qQXVJgzhWj6k3yrDs8730.00000000 VIA1311.39 DKK164.61 DKK
 
VuMnsLFtFM9GbTLRgk7vtRsUS7FmmmfqHV668.17592834 VIA1200.33 DKK150.67 DKK
EQ6FBPLrcWPkYYMbPhAvYWEDqiTRvC3X1L61.80167166 VIA111.02 DKK13.94 DKK×